5.7.2  软件升级方法

5.7.2 软件升级方法

1.U盘升级操作步骤

升级文件(扩展名为.sks)放入U盘,进入USB,切换到文本这一项,用遥控操作选择到此文件,按“确定”键进行升级。升级时,会先进行文件内容的检测,如果两个软件的机心名不一样时会提示机心不一样,不允许升级;如果两个软件的屏不一样时,也会提示。此时如果要强制升级,请再按一次“确定”键进行升级。升级过程中,请不要关闭电源,升级时间大约为2min,请耐心等待。

2.工装升级方法和步骤

(1)硬件工具

计算机1台、专用升级工装1个、并口线1根、通用VGA线1根、USB连接线1根。

(2)硬件连接方法

1)将通用并口线一端连接到升级工装的输入端口上,另一端连接到计算机的“并口”上。

2)将通用VGA线一端连接到升级工装的输出端端口上,另一端连接到待升级的整机VGA端口上。

3)连接工装输出端的USB接口与计算机的USB接口。

4)TV整机上电,遥控开机,使整机处于正常工作状态。

(3)HDMI KEY烧录说明

1)EEPROM 24C32的器件地址是A0。

2)第一次烧录程序后,交流断电再开机会初始化EEPROM 24C32(同时会写一个默认HDMI KEY和特征码)。

3)HDMI KEY存储在24C32末尾,从0xE90开始,共329个字节。特征码存在第2个字节(即地址0x01处),值为0x22。BarCode存储在24C32最后32个字节,从0xfe0开始。

4)因8K29本身芯片当中没有带HDMI KEY,虽然生产母片里已经写了一个通用KEY用于生产线检验,但整机打包前还需要写一个唯一的KEY,每台机器对应一个,不能重复,烧录HDMI KEY需要条码预调读写仪Ⅲ(支持24C32)和母片口存储该订单HDMI KEY的Flash。HDMI KEY文件的制作:

①先用HDCP-Key-for-Skyworth-exe把KEY文件抽取出来;

②用工程部提供的HDMI KEY制作软件V1.3版本处理KEY文件(请选择ADI公司);

③把KEY文件烧录到FLASH中,就可以用在条码预调读写仪Ⅲ上。

5)按工厂遥控器的“总线”键(3AH键)把主板的I2 C总线关闭,此时屏幕显示“BUSOFF”。

6)条码仪硬件连接:条码仪有个四芯排线,包含+5V、SCL、SDA和GND,由于条码仪和主板排插CN19的1脚电压可能有冲突,+5V脚必须不连,请调整排线脚位,使条码仪排线片脚顺序与主板插座CN19的脚位定义相配。条码仪上地址芯片可用文件包中的文件(8K28HDMI烧录地址母片.bin)进行烧录。

7)插上接口线(8K29烧录HDMI KEY接口线插在CN19),用扫描枪扫描条码,当读写仪上显示出“OK”时,烧写完成。拔掉接口线,按“总线”键(3AH键)开启主板的I2 C总线,进行下一道工序处理。

8)如果条码仪提示机芯有误,是特征值不对,8K29在EEPROM处0x01的值是0x22。

(4)HDCP-Key-for-Skyworth.exe工具的详细使用说明

1)MTK的HDCP生成工具包括两个文件:HDCP-Key-for-Skyworth.exe和HD-CP-DLL.d11,使用时需要把这两个文件放在同一个目录里,打开HDCP-Key-for-Skyworth.exe,出现如图5-87所示对话框。

2)在图5-87所示的对话框里,请先在最左边的文件管理器里找到KEY原始文件的位置,然后在中间的选择栏选择KEY的原始文件,如图5-88所示。

3)选择好原始KEY文件,然后在右边的中间输入框里输入本次操作需要生成的KEY的起始点(在原始KEY文件的序号“Key Offset”)和需要生成的KEY的个数“Output#”,最后单击右边上面的“Gen HDCP”按钮把KEY切割出来,如图5-89所示。提示OK后请关闭弹出来的OK提示框,单击右边上面的“Merge”按钮,如图5-89所示。

978-7-111-47661-0-Chapter05-87.jpg

图5-87

978-7-111-47661-0-Chapter05-88.jpg

图5-88

978-7-111-47661-0-Chapter05-89.jpg

图5-89

4)按下“Merger”按钮后,工具自动合并文件,此时会出现图5-90的提示框,提示生成的文件的保存位置,请设置需要保存的位置和文件名,按下保存按钮进行保存,最后退出。

注意:在进行HDCPKEY的切割前,请先把上次生成的临时文件夹“output-keys-0”删除,以免每次KEY的数目不一样时生成的最后.bin文件的KEY数目不是我们需要的个数。

978-7-111-47661-0-Chapter05-90.jpg

图5-90

(5)MTK升级工具的使用说明

1)打开MTK升级工具程序“MtkTool.exe”,出现如图5-91所示窗口。

此工具用的是串口,而我们电视端用的是VGA口转换的,因此请用公司发的USB标准串口转接线来进行升级(先要把串口小板的拨动开关拨到串口UART这一边)。在打开升级工具之前,请先把USB串口接好,再打开升级工具,否则会出现找不到串口的问题。打开Mtk-Tool.exe后出现上面的主界面,请确认如下设置:

①把最左边的IC型号选择为MT8226;

②把中间的串口选为实际接入的USB串口,并确认后面的速度设为115200和10ms;

③把中间的“!”按钮按一下,确认为绿色而不是红色,红色表示关闭串口,而绿色表示打开串口。

2)按“Browse”按钮选择升级文件,升级文件是.bin文件,但为了USB升级用,提供的文件把扩展名改为.sks,因此在打开文件时,请选择文件类型为“Allfiles(∗.∗)”,再选择升级文件并打开,如图5-92所示。

978-7-111-47661-0-Chapter05-91.jpg

图5-91

978-7-111-47661-0-Chapter05-92.jpg

图5-92

3)在主界面单击“Upgrade”按钮开始升级,升级过程中请不要断电。开始是擦除过程,此时无进度条显示,进度条为0%,擦除完成后开始写入,此时有进度条在变化,当进度条显示为100%时,升级完成,请断电再开机。

(6)使用M-FK升级工具烧写HDMI KEY说明

如果HDMI图像出不来或有图像无声音,怀疑是HDMI key有问题时,也可以用此升级工具写入一个通用KEY进行校验,具体方法如下:

1)打开MTK升级工具,单击上面中间的按钮(如图中圆圈所示),出现图5-93的窗口,同时请关闭再打开串口(用鼠标点击中间的感叹号的按钮)。

2)用鼠标单击右边的“HDCP”按钮,出现如图5-94所示的HDCP写入工具对话框。

978-7-111-47661-0-Chapter05-93.jpg

图5-93

978-7-111-47661-0-Chapter05-94.jpg

图5-94

3)在图5-94中,请按“LoadValue”按钮选择一个我们提供的通用KEY文件,如图5-95所示。

4)在图5-94的界面中按“Write”按钮进行写入的动作,写入完成后会出现图5-96所示的成功提示“Verification Pass!”。完成后请断电再开机,以便让IC重新初始化新的KEY。

978-7-111-47661-0-Chapter05-95.jpg

图5-95

978-7-111-47661-0-Chapter05-96.jpg

图5-96